Analia has been kept a prisoner for many years, and suffered great pains in the meantime. One day, she is lucky to escape her cell and smuggle into a merchant spaceship to get as far away as possible from that horrible place. That’s where she meets Sebastian, for he is the captain of the ship, and finds her nearly dead from starvation and exhaustion.

The book was alright, and the premise sounded interesting enough. Unfortunately the writing let it down for me, as it wasn’t to my style (e.g., the sentence structure, and sentences were too short). The writing sometimes looked very... juvenile, if that makes any sense. Like the writer doesn’t have much writing experience.

Furthermore, there were quite some grammatical errors which also made the story hard to enjoy, so I would suggest having a proper look around the book again and edit it where needed.

A spaceship, a stowaway, a demon captain and a evil nemesis. OH MY!!
This was a enjoyable change of pace from my same old same old. Sebastian is a demon and the captain of his ship. Analia has been a slave for as long as she can remember.She stows away as her only escape from the horror she has endured.
They are destined mates and there attraction is immediate.
I loved all the quirky characters and am looking forward to reading there books.
There is a little resemblance to a couple of other series I have read in the past but not enough to take away from this story.

This was actually the first novel I had read from this author that had made me fall in love with her characters. Anya is incredibly brave and powerful although she experiences incredible cruelty and pain. She is able to overcome that trauma and turn it into strength. With Sebastian's help she is able to experience the freedom and beauty of her surroundings in a safe place.
I loved Sebastian most of all because he is a fierce but gentle demon. He uses his strength to protect Anya and his heart to bring her comfort and happiness. He is so in tune with her desires and ensures she is comfortable with his sexual advances.
Also enjoyed the other crew members that become fiercely loyal to Anya and help enrich the story. Can't wait to read their stories!
